Feature: Search
As a user
I want to search for resources in the space
So that I can get them quickly
Note - this feature is run in CI with ACCOUNTS_HASH_DIFFICULTY set to the default for production
See https://github.com/owncloud/ocis/issues/1542 and https://github.com/owncloud/ocis/pull/839
Background:
Given these users have been created with default attributes and without skeleton files:
| username |
| Alice |
| Brian |
And using spaces DAV path
And the administrator has assigned the role "Space Admin" to user "Alice" using the Graph API
And user "Alice" has created a space "find data" with the default quota using the GraphApi
And user "Alice" has created a folder "folderMain/SubFolder1/subFOLDER2" in space "find data"
And user "Alice" has uploaded a file inside space "find data" with content "some content" to "folderMain/SubFolder1/subFOLDER2/insideTheFolder.txt"
And using new DAV path
Scenario: user can find data from the project space
When user "Alice" searches for "fol" using the WebDAV API
Then the HTTP status code should be "207"
And the search result should contain "4" entries
And the search result of user "Alice" should contain these entries:
| /folderMain |
| /folderMain/SubFolder1 |
| /folderMain/SubFolder1/subFOLDER2 |
| /folderMain/SubFolder1/subFOLDER2/insideTheFolder.txt |
Scenario: user can only find data that they searched for from the project space
When user "Alice" searches for "SUB" using the WebDAV API
Then the HTTP status code should be "207"
And the search result should contain "2" entries
And the search result of user "Alice" should contain these entries:
| /folderMain/SubFolder1 |
| /folderMain/SubFolder1/subFOLDER2 |
But the search result of user "Alice" should not contain these entries:
| /folderMain |
| /folderMain/SubFolder1/subFOLDER2/insideTheFolder.txt |
Scenario: user can find data from the shares
Given user "Alice" has created a share inside of space "find data" with settings:
| path | folderMain |
| shareWith | Brian |
| role | viewer |
And user "Brian" has accepted share "/folderMain" offered by user "Alice"
When user "Brian" searches for "folder" using the WebDAV API
Then the HTTP status code should be "207"
And the search result should contain "4" entries
And the search result of user "Brian" should contain these entries:
| /SubFolder1 |
| /SubFolder1/subFOLDER2 |
| /SubFolder1/subFOLDER2/insideTheFolder.txt |
And for user "Brian" the search result should contain space "mountpoint/folderMain"
